Last Updated:November 22, 2025, 21:51 IST DK Shivakumar declared he would “quit politics” if it were proven that he had been in touch with Union Home Minister Amit Shah Karnataka deputy chief minister DK Shivakumar (Photo: PTI) Karnataka Deputy Chief Minister DK Shivakumar on Saturday launched a sharp attack on Union Minister HD Kumaraswamy, declaring he would “quit politics” if it were proven that he had been in touch with Union Home Minister Amit Shah. The remark came during a press conference on issues related to the Greater Bengaluru Authority and the Bengaluru Development Authority. Reacting to what he believed was Kumaraswamy’s claim that the Congress government in Karnataka could collapse soon and that Shivakumar was allegedly in contact with Shah, the Deputy CM called the JD(S) leader a “traitor” and warned that he might file a defamation case. Twist After Outburst However, the confrontation took an unexpected turn when Shivakumar’s team later discovered that Kumaraswamy had made no such remarks.
